Output 3b64eab0cb113a7536ea0f64a58ebd166df3ec852b31915420bdce56af6354f6:2

value
263587863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74cbd34bbb9a8af6afb4728397f7de5a23b96bb9 OP_EQUAL
address
3CLaUqAyhcL3WBEen1ZuwHVJRMw8dHE61C
transaction
3b64eab0cb113a7536ea0f64a58ebd166df3ec852b31915420bdce56af6354f6
spent
true